Match Commentary

  • 24': Renat Dadashov (Tondela)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 26': Modibo Sagnan (Tondela)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 31': Goal! Arouca 1, Tondela 0. João Basso (Arouca) converts the penalty with a right footed shot to the centre of the goal.
  • 35': Eboue Kouassi (Arouca)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 45'+3': First Half ends, Arouca 1, Tondela 0.
  • 45': Second Half begins Arouca 1, Tondela 0.
  • 50': Rafael Barbosa (Tondela)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 57': Substitution, Tondela. Naoufel Khacef replaces Neto Borges because of an injury.
  • 57': Substitution, Tondela. Tiago Dantas replaces Rafael Barbosa.
  • 58': Substitution, Tondela. Juan Manuel Boselli replaces Jhon Murillo.
  • 63': Naoufel Khacef (Tondela)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 67': Substitution, Arouca. Pité replaces Pedro Moreira because of an injury.
  • 68': Goal! Arouca 2, Tondela 0. André Bukia (Arouca) left footed shot from outside the box to the bottom left corner.
  • 75': Substitution, Tondela. Arcanjo replaces Pedro Augusto.
  • 80': Substitution, Arouca. Adilio replaces André Bukia.
  • 80': Substitution, Tondela. Manu Hernando replaces Modibo Sagnan.
  • 82': Pité (Arouca)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 90': Thales (Arouca)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 90'+2': Substitution, Arouca. Oday Dabbagh replaces André Silva.
  • 90'+3': Substitution, Arouca. Tiago Esgaio replaces Mateus Quaresma because of an injury.
  • 90'+3': Adilio (Arouca)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 90'+5': Second yellow card to Pité (Arouca) for a bad foul.
